Peter Michielutti

Peter Michielutti

Vice President and Chief Financial Officer

Peter Michielutti serves as the vice president and chief financial officer for CSM Corporation. Michielutti's primary objectives include overseeing the company's financial operations, developing new processes and aligning systems that will allow CSM to expand and to grow exponentially with new ventures.

Prior to joining CSM in 2009, Michielutti gained over 25 years of managerial experience in a variety of finance-related roles. Most recently, Michielutti held executive positions with Fingerhut, US Bancorp, Wilsons Leather, and Whitehall Jewelers. Over the course of his career, he has had the opportunity to work around the country with a variety of diverse organizations. Additionally, Michielutti has experience working with companies who have experienced rapid growth and with those who have experienced financial challenges. His broad base of knowledge will be integral to CSM's strategic growth.

Michelle Culligan

Michelle Culligan

General Counsel

Michelle Culligan currently serves as General Counsel for CSM Corporation representing the company in various commercial real estate matters, financings, general commercial and corporate matters, as well as mitigation of issues for CSM’s diverse portfolio of commercial, residential and hotel properties. Her 23 plus years of legal experience includes representing clients in negotiating and documenting various complex commercial and real estate financing transactions, structuring workouts for struggling real estate loans,  real estate acquisitions, development, leasing, and sales, as well as counseling clients on a wide range of real estate, financing, and general corporate matters.

Prior to joining CSM, Michelle was a principal and general counsel at Manchester Companies in Minneapolis, MN, and has also provided corporate real estate advisory services to clients as a commercial real estate broker at AREA, LLC.   Michelle practiced for over 13 years at Briggs and Morgan, P.A. where she was a partner in the Financial Services/Real Estate department, and 5 years as a partner at the law firm of Dunkley and Bennett, PA.  She received her J.D. from the University of Minnesota, after graduating summa cum laude from Drake University, and also obtained a mini master in Real Estate Development from the University of St. Thomas.




Bill Franke

Bill Franke

Special Counsel

Bill Franke has been with CSM since 1993 first serving as general counsel and most recently moving into a special counsel role. He serves on the foundation, the Gary Holmes family office and is a trustee. Early in his CSM career, Bill was instrumental in growing CSM's diverse portfolio of hotel properties, from inception through successful completion. Bill's legal expertise was integral in acquiring, developing, and renovating 38 hotels, including The Milwaukee Road Depot, Residence Inn, and TownePlace Suites. These downtown Minneapolis hotels required extensive legal work prior to acquisition, construction, and renovation. After the sites were finished, CSM was required to submit further documentation to comply with state, city, and local historical society regulations. In addition, Bill worked with various community organizations, local, regional, and state governments across the country to mitigate issues from construction and financing to human resources and hotel development.

Before joining CSM, Bill worked in private practice and was president of The Everest Group

Brad Kittleson

Brad Kittleson

Vice President of Property Management

With 30 years of property management experience, Brad Kittleson has been a driving force in the success of CSM since joining the company in 1988. As vice president of Property Management, his knowledge, leadership, and work ethic have contributed to the company's award-winning results. Brad oversees CSM's Residential department consisting of more than 3,100 residential units in nine states, housing more than 10,000 residents. He also leads the Commercial Property Management department responsible for more than 11 million square feet and 110 properties in five states. Brad manages the CSM in-house maintenance team, ProTech, which provides full-service maintenance and tenant improvement services.

Prior to joining CSM, Brad worked for the Milwaukee-based Decade Companies where he was responsible for daily property management, renovations and repositioning of properties.
